GOV. SULE INAUGURATES CAMPAIGN COUNCIL, DISTRIBUTES VEHICLES TO SUPPORT GROUPS

Nasarawa State Governor, Engr. Abdullahi Sule, has inaugurated his senatorial campaign council for the 2027 general polls.

Inaugurating the 16-man campaign council in Akwanga, the headquarters of Nasarawa North, on Saturday, Governor Sule urged them to demonstrate leadership, discipline and values in the mobilization of the grassroots for the race to win the forthcoming polls.

He enjoined the team to focus on its mandate which is considered to be results-driven, people-focused and issue-based devoid of acrimony and discrimination.

Engr. Sule emphasized the essence of responsive leadership that reflects accountability, development, quality representation and harmonious co-existence, expressing his determination to ensure inclusiveness and growth in the zone.

Giving an overview of the campaign council, the Director-General of the A. A. Sule Campaign Council, Hon. Bala Moses commended the governor for reposing unstinting confidence in them to steer his campaign bid, adding that the All Progressives Congress (APC) would emerge victorious at all levels.

He noted that the council which constitutes of highly revered grassroots politicians, sectoral experts, experienced technocrats and administrators is built on the right footing to match to victory and deliver good governance to the zone.

The event was attended by members and leaders of the All Progressives Congress (APC) across the three local government areas of Wamba, Nasarawa Eggon and Akwanga.

Meanwhile, the governor commissioned his campaign office along Keffi Road in Akwanga and distributed campaign vehicles to the council and various support groups.
